Number One: The horrific nature of the crime as taken from Steve Huffs article--
The bodies of Tori Vienneau, 22, and her 10-month-old son, Dean Springstube, were discovered in an apartment in the 1400 block of 45th Street on Wednesday night. One of two women who shared the apartment with Vienneau found her sprawled against a couch in the front room, police said. The baby was found hanging from a noose in his crib, according to police sources… (Sentence in bold was added by the author)
And Number Two: And again, thanks to Steve, for pointing this out. This particularly horrific crime, commited back in July of 2006, holds VERY little information as to the investigation and usual progress one would expect in such a case.
In fact, It's quite startling to do a google search on the victims name and only come up with a handful of related articles. As opposed to high profile cases, like Jon Benet Ramsey, or Natalie Holloway or The slain Virgina Beach Student Taylor Behl who have literally tens of thousands "Hits" associated with their names,
Only a few articles were found in the mainstream media, All from the same Newspaper- The San Diego Union-Tribune. Here's one of them

The only purpose of this blog is that if ANYONE should stumble across this blog and KNOWS anything, no matter how slight or inconsequential to contact the authorities.
Police are asking anyone who may have known Tori Vienneau – or the people in her life – to call San Diego police at (619) 293-2293 or Crime Stoppers at (888) 580-TIPS.
